理解并正确设置端口转发

在互联网技术中,端口转发是一种常见的网络连接方式,它允许将数据包从源主机传输到目标主机,而无需改变它们的原始路径,对于一些特定的应用场景,我们需要对端口转发进行适当的配置和管理。

端口转发的基本原理

端口转发的主要目的是为了提高网络通信效率,当应用程序需要访问一个服务器时,它可以使用端口转发将请求发送到多个服务器,然后由这些服务器之一处理请求,这种方法可以大大减少网络通信的时间,从而提高整体性能。

设置端口转发的基本步骤

1、查看当前已有的端口列表:大多数操作系统都提供了命令行工具来查看已有的端口列表,如在Linux系统中,可以使用netstat -anp | grep "listen" | wc -l命令。

2、添加新的端口:接下来,你需要添加一个新的端口,你可以通过运行sudo ufw allow port <port>命令来允许特定端口的访问,如果你想允许所有80端口(默认端口)的流量,你可以在防火墙规则中写入sudo ufw allow all 80

3、配置端口转发:添加新端口后,你需要为每个端口指定一个转发规则,这些规则应该包含源主机的IP地址和目的主机的IP地址,以及任何其他可能影响转发结果的信息,如端口号范围等。

4、检查端口转发是否生效:你应该验证端口转发是否已经生效,这通常可以通过在命令行中输入ufw statusip link show eth0来完成。

端口转发是一种非常实用的技术,但同时也需要注意其设置过程中的细节,理解并正确设置端口转发,可以帮助我们在网络环境中更高效地进行通信,同时也能保护我们的网络安全。

发表评论

评论列表

还没有评论,快来说点什么吧~